Administrative history
The Department of Agriculture and Agri-Food Canada was established by the Department of Agriculture Act in 1868. This Act, which is occassionally amended, is the authority under which the present Department operates.

Scope and content
Collection consists of four volumes of [livestock] Import Inspection records kept by the Canadian Department of Agriculture from 1907-1930. Most of the volumes are for Bridgeburg, Ont. (present-day Fort Erie, Ont.), with one volume for Niagara Falls, Ont. Fonds consists of the following series: Bridgeburg, Ont. April 1, 1907-August 20, 1910 Bridgeburg, Ont. August 27, 1910-July 9, 1921 Bridgeburg, Ont. November 10, 1928-September 13, 1930 Niagara Falls, Ont. April 5, 1919-November 25, 1922
